In pursuance of highest standards of corporate governance and in line with SEBI's revised Listing Obligations and Disclosure Regulations (Regulation 17(1B) of SEBI LODR, 2015) with regard to separation of roles of Chairman and Managing Director, and that the persons holding these responsibilities should not be related to each other.
Also, as per the said clause, the chairperson of the company has to be a non-executive director.
Accordingly, the Nomination and Remuneration Committee ('NRC') of the company has recommended a structured and comprehensive change in Senior Management. Based on the NRC Committee recommendation, the Board has considered and approved the following, subject to any approval, if applicable:
The company is pleased to announce the appointment of Ramesh Joshi as the 'Non-Executive Chairman' of the company with immediate effect. This would improve the corporate governance standards as well as further enhance the independence of the Board.
* In his distinguished and illustrious career sprawling over 40 plus years, he has held several leadership positions in the Reserve Bank of India and has been Nominee Director on behalf of RBI on the Boards of Various Banks, and retired as an Executive Director of SEBI.
* He is also on the Panel of Arbitrators for NSE, BSE and MCX.
* He will serve as a mentor and continue as a guiding force for the Managing Director on issues presented to the Board, especially in the areas of corporate governance practices and all types of business risk assessment and mitigation initiatives. He shall also continue and be available to provide feedback and consultation to the Managing Director on any critical issues faced by the company.
Also, the company is pleased to announce the re-designation of Dinesh Nandwana to the role of 'Managing Director and Group CEO' in place of Anil Khanna with immediate effect.
